The EN 13601 Copper Bus Bar is produced from electrolytic tough-pitch (ETP) copper with a minimum purity of 99.9%. Known for its superior electrical and thermal conductivity, it is ideal for high-current and low-loss power transmission in electrical panels, substations, and renewable energy systems throughout the UAE.

| Parameter | Typical Values |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Material | Electrolytic Tough Pitch (ETP) Copper (C11000) | May vary depending on application |
| Conductivity | ≥ 97.3% IACS (International Annealed Copper Standard) | High conductivity is crucial for efficient current flow |
| Dimensions | Width: Varies widely (e.g., 10mm to 200mm) <br> Thickness: Varies widely (e.g., 1.6mm to 20mm) <br> Length: Customized to application requirements | Standard sizes available, but often custom-made |
| Shape | Rectangular (most common), Square, Round, I-beam, T-bar | Selected based on current carrying capacity and mechanical requirements |
| Surface Finish | Smooth, polished, or with grooves (for cooling) | Affects current carrying capacity and heat dissipation |
| Mechanical Properties | Tensile Strength, Yield Strength, Elongation | Ensure adequate mechanical strength for handling and installation |
| Thermal Properties | Thermal Conductivity | Important for heat dissipation |
| Current Carrying Capacity | Varies significantly based on dimensions, cooling method, and ambient temperature | Critical for proper sizing and safe operation |

| Element | Percentage |
|---|---|
| Copper (Cu) | 99.90% min. |
| Oxygen (O2) | 0.060% max. |
| Other Impurities | Trace amounts |
